    • A process control scheme for use with an extruding apparatus for cooling and heating aerated or compressible compounds that are edible. Broadly, the process includes providing a mixture to an inlet of the extruding apparatus, monitoring the pressure profile across the extruding apparatus, moving the mixture through the extruding apparatus with at least one auger while subjecting the mixture to a thermo-dynamic process, automatically altering speed of the at least one auger if the pressure profile across the extruding apparatus is outside a predetermined range, and moving the mixture through an outlet of the extruding apparatus. The process may also include monitoring temperature of a thermodynamic liquid, monitoring the load of an auger motor, and automatically altering the temperature of the thermodynamic liquid and the load of the auger motor if one of either the temperature of the thermodynamic liquid and the load of the auger motor is outside a predetermined range.

    • An apparatus includes a housing, a heat conductive container for receiving yogurt ingredients, a heating unit installed in the housing and provided with a heating element for heating the container, a cooling unit installed in the housing and provided with a refrigerant pipe for cooling the container by a refrigeration cycle caused by supplying electric power, a stirring unit provided with a stirring blade which is driven by a motor to be rotated in the container, and a control unit configured to selectively control the heating unit, the cooling unit and the stirring unit to make frozen yogurt of the yogurt ingredients. A method includes steps for preparing frozen yogurt using the apparatus, wherein the frozen yogurt is fermented, ripened and frozen under control of the control unit within a single container, for example. In alternative examples, other fermented yogurt and non-fermented ice cream or sherbet products are made using the same apparatus.
